Implement LimitOffsetListenableFuturePagingSource

An abstract implementation of ListenableFuturePagingSource to be
implemented by Room. Supports Guava operations through ListenableFuture.

+@RestrictTo(RestrictTo.Scope.LIBRARY_GROUP)
+abstract class LimitOffsetListenableFuturePagingSource<Value : Any>(
+    private val sourceQuery: RoomSQLiteQuery,
+    private val db: RoomDatabase,
+    vararg tables: String
+) : ListenableFuturePagingSource<Int, Value>() {
+
+    constructor(
+        supportSQLiteQuery: SupportSQLiteQuery,
+        db: RoomDatabase,
+        vararg tables: String,
+    ) : this(
+        sourceQuery = RoomSQLiteQuery.copyFrom(supportSQLiteQuery),
+        db = db,
+        tables = tables,
+    )
+
+    // internal for testing visibility
+    internal val itemCount: AtomicInteger = AtomicInteger(INITIAL_ITEM_COUNT)
+    private val observer = ThreadSafeInvalidationObserver(tables = tables, ::invalidate)
+
+    /**
+    * Returns a [ListenableFuture] immediately before loading from the database completes
+    *
+    * If PagingSource is invalidated while the [ListenableFuture] is still pending, the
+    * invalidation will cancel the load() coroutine that calls await() on this future. The
+    * cancellation of await() will transitively cancel this future as well.
+    */
+    override fun loadFuture(params: LoadParams<Int>): ListenableFuture<LoadResult<Int, Value>> {
+        observer.registerIfNecessary(db)
+        val tempCount = itemCount.get()
+        return if (tempCount == INITIAL_ITEM_COUNT) {
+            initialLoad(params)
+        } else {
+            nonInitialLoad(params, tempCount)
+        }
+    }
+
+    /**
+    * For refresh loads
+    *
+    * To guarantee a valid initial load, it is run in transaction so that db writes cannot
+    * happen in between [queryItemCount] and [queryDatabase] to ensure a valid [itemCount].
+    * [itemCount] must be correct in order to calculate correct LIMIT and OFFSET for the query.
+    *
+    *
+    * However, the database load will be canceled via the cancellation signal if the future
+    * it returned has been canceled before it has completed.
+    */
+    private fun initialLoad(params: LoadParams<Int>): ListenableFuture<LoadResult<Int, Value>> {
+        val cancellationSignal = createCancellationSignal()
+        val loadCallable = Callable<LoadResult<Int, Value>> {
+            db.runInTransaction(
+                Callable {
+                    val tempCount = queryItemCount(sourceQuery, db)
+                    itemCount.set(tempCount)
+                    queryDatabase(
+                        params, sourceQuery, db, tempCount, cancellationSignal, ::convertRows
+                    )
+                }
+            )
+        }
+
+        return createListenableFuture(
+            db,
+            true,
+            loadCallable,
+            sourceQuery,
+            false,
+            cancellationSignal,
+        )
+    }
+
+    /**
+    * For append and prepend loads
+    *
+    * The cancellation signal cancels room database operation if its running, or cancels it
+    * the moment it starts. The signal is triggered when the future is canceled.
+    */
+    private fun nonInitialLoad(
+        params: LoadParams<Int>,
+        tempCount: Int
+    ): ListenableFuture<LoadResult<Int, Value>> {
+        val cancellationSignal = createCancellationSignal()
+        val loadCallable = Callable<LoadResult<Int, Value>> {
+            val result = queryDatabase(
+                params, sourceQuery, db, tempCount, cancellationSignal, ::convertRows
+            )
+            db.invalidationTracker.refreshVersionsAsync()
+            @Suppress("UNCHECKED_CAST")
+            if (invalid) INVALID as LoadResult.Invalid<Int, Value> else result
+        }
+
+        return createListenableFuture(
+            db,
+            false,
+            loadCallable,
+            sourceQuery,
+            false,
+            cancellationSignal
+        )
+    }
+
+    @NonNull
+    protected abstract fun convertRows(cursor: Cursor): List<Value>
+
+    override val jumpingSupported: Boolean
+        get() = true
+
+    override fun getRefreshKey(state: PagingState<Int, Value>): Int? {
+         return state.getClippedRefreshKey()
+    }
+}
